Jeedikal - Lingalaghanpur, Jangoan
Jeedikal is a village situated in the Lingalaghanpur mandal of Jangoan district, Telangana. It is located approximately 12 km from Lingalaghanpur and around 67 km from Warangal. Jeedikal village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Jeedikal is 578252. The village covers a total geographical area of 995 hectares and falls under the 506201 pincode. Jangaon is the nearest town, located about 12 km away.
Jeedikal village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Jeedikal
As per Census 2011, Jeedikal village has a total population of 1,861 people, consisting of 937 males and 924 females. The village has 441 households and a sex ratio of 986 females per 1,000 males. There are 166 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 966 literate and 895 illiterate residents. Additionally, 339 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 18 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Jeedikal are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,861 | 937 | 924 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 166 | 82 | 84 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 339 | 167 | 172 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 18 | 8 | 10 |
| Literate Population | 966 | 577 | 389 |
| Illiterate Population | 895 | 360 | 535 |

Transport and Connectivity of Jeedikal
Jeedikal is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Jeedikal.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Jangaon to Jeedikal is about 12 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Warangal to Jeedikal is about 67 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.9 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Jeedikal
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Jeedikal village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Jeedikal
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Jeedikal village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
